School Days HQ is one of my favorite eroge officially released in English.

 

I gave School Days an 8/10. This game is really polarizing, as it's both innovative yet highly flawed.
 
Pros:
Animated VN: These are really rare.
Interactivity / choices: The plot is highly branching and the the game is very responsive to your choices, providing a level of dialogue "gameplay" that's rare in VNs. The branching also makes the game highly replayable.
Semi-realistic drama: The love triangle is somewhat contrived but usually entertaining. It's fascinating how the game nudges you towards indecisiveness by reminding you that every choice has both positive and negative consequences. The way the game satirizes the typical bland and indecisive VN protagonist while drawing you into his shoes is somewhat ingenious. 
 
Cons:
Some paths through the game are nonsensical (the game's scenario's is broken into segments that are supposed to fit together like pieces in a puzzle, but sometimes the pieces don't quite fit)
The bugs: The game is unstable and crashes about once every few hours.
Low quality graphics: The animation quality is poor and cuts corners everywhere, significantly impacting the experience.
 
Overall, School Days is a diamond in the rough: a highly ambitious game that tries to do many things and doesn't do any of them very well. If you're looking for a highly polished, thoughtful, and traditional VN, School Days will not satisfy. If you're looking for something completely different, you like highly branching plots, you like the love triangle theme, at least one of the heroines appeals to you, and you're willing to put up with the crashes, then School Days may very well impress you.
 
In the end, School Days HQ is the best fully animated love triangle eroge in English. It's also the only one.

I thought the animation was incredibly bad. The h-scenes were slightly better but still really bad. I thought those were so bad that it was impossible to find them erotic, they were actually comical. Anyways, I wrote multiple large effort posts on School Days in the "What are you playing?" thread and some are lost to the forums rollback. I won't bother recreating them but the gist of it is that I think it's a kind of bad game. Most people shit on the game with Makoto hate but I thought he was fine. I think most of the Makoto haters only watched the anime, but he's fine in the game, where you're in control and can make him do sensible things. The main areas I hated were the animation (extremely bad), the sometimes inconsistent characters, the branching structure of the game being unnecessarily convoluted, making completing multiple routes a real pain in the ass (especially with how they used both choices and relationship points to determine the paths). I also had some more specific complaints, like how the Setsuna "route" was handled. The good points include how the amount choices really does pull you into the world, and the realism of the drama. Realistic drama isn't always good, and it's not necessarily fully realistic in School Days, but it feels like the game was written by people who actually know how teenagers talk and interact with each other which is rare in eroge. Some of the plot points were just a little bit too convenient in some of the routes, though.

 

Overall I felt that the bad outweighed the good, and I don't particularly like School Days, but I didn't hate it either and I thought it was a pretty interesting experience and I don't regret my time with it. I'm now actually pretty interested in Shiny Days, too.
